Blue Tigers win final game in Hilton Holiday Classic

ST. LOUIS - Jennifer Rosado scored 15 points and Angela Randall added 10 as the Lincoln women's basketball team held on to a 66-62 win over Harris Stowe State in the final round of the Hilton Holiday Classic on Saturday afternoon.

The Hornets jumped out to a 6-3 lead, but Lincoln responded with an 18-4 run to take a lead that would never completely relinquish. After trailing by 12 with 5:59 left in the second half, Harris Stowe (2-6) mounted a 22-10 run to tie the game at 62 with 1:59 remaining.

Jackeya Mitchell, who scored nine points and recorded six rebounds, forced a steal and converted on the other end to give the Blue Tigers a two-point lead with 1:26 to go. Nesha Wright and Rosado both hit a free throw and the Lincoln defense didn't allow another point to secure the victory.

Lincoln was just 21-of-61 (34 percent) from the field and 4-of-19 (21 percent) from behind the arc, but the Blue Tigers claimed a 42-33 rebounding advantage, scored 25 points off 25 Hornet turnovers, and hit 20 free throws in their final non-conference game of the season.

The Blue Tigers have 19-straight games against MIAA opponents, starting with a home matchup against Northeastern State on Thursday at 5:30 p.m.
